Easy Learning with Free Google Maps API Course for Beginners
Development > Web Development
Test Course
Free
4.8

Enroll Now

Language: English

Interactive Web Maps: Free Google Maps API Fundamentals Course

What you will learn:

  • Establish and fine-tune Google Maps integration within web development projects, including fundamental controls and point-of-interest indicators.
  • Graphically represent and personalize diverse geometric overlays on maps, such as circular areas, multi-sided polygons, sequential polylines, and rectangular regions.
  • Implement robust handlers for user engagement and mapping events, encompassing click interactions, magnification level adjustments, and changes in visible map boundaries.
  • Deploy advanced marker management techniques, including visual customization and intelligent clustering, to optimize the display of numerous geographic data points and enhance overall map responsiveness.

Description

[UPDATE - Feb 2026] Subtitles available: Spanish, Portuguese (Brazil), Japanese, Chinese

Revolutionize your web applications by integrating captivating, interactive maps! Our complimentary introductory program, "Interactive Web Maps: Free Google Maps API Fundamentals Course," is meticulously crafted for aspiring web developers, curious hobbyists, and students eager to master the Google Maps API. Embark on a journey from foundational concepts to implementing core functionalities such as dynamic markers, custom geometric shapes, responsive event handling, and techniques for enhanced user experiences.


What you’ll gain from this course:

  • Gain proficiency in initializing Google Maps within your web environments, along with configuring essential map controls and display options.

  • Discover how to strategically place and personalize interactive map markers, create informative pop-up InfoWindows, and implement engaging marker animations.

  • Master the art of overlaying and styling various geospatial shapes, including circles, polygons, polylines, and rectangles, to highlight specific regions or paths.

  • Develop the capability to respond dynamically to user interactions and map events, such as click actions, zoom level modifications, and changes in geographical boundaries.

  • Learn effective strategies for organizing and presenting numerous markers through advanced clustering methodologies, enhancing map readability and performance.

  • Enhance your learning experience with comprehensive, professionally translated multilingual subtitles, available in Spanish (ES), Brazilian Portuguese (PT-BR), Japanese (JA), and Chinese (ZH).

Who should enroll in this course:

  • Individuals new to web development or existing developers seeking a comprehensive, ground-up introduction to the Google Maps API.

  • Students and passionate hobbyists with an interest in crafting engaging, location-aware applications and interactive mapping solutions.

  • Anyone desiring a practical, project-based pathway to understanding map visualization, user interaction, and geospatial data presentation.

Prerequisites for the course:

  • A foundational understanding of web technologies, including HTML for structure, CSS for styling, and JavaScript for interactivity.

  • Possession of a Google account is necessary to obtain your free Google Maps API key.

  • Absolutely no previous exposure to the Google Maps API is required – we start from the very beginning.

Don't miss this opportunity to begin crafting powerful, interactive maps for your digital projects. Enroll in this complimentary, beginner-focused Google Maps API course today and lay the groundwork for becoming proficient in location-based web development!

Curriculum

Module 1 – Map Initialization & Core Controls

In this foundational module, you will embark on your Google Maps API journey. We'll guide you through the initial steps of setting up and rendering a basic Google Map on your webpage. You'll master configuring essential user interface controls such as zoom and pan, ensuring intuitive navigation for your users. Furthermore, you'll learn the crucial skill of placing your very first interactive marker on the map, complete with an InfoWindow – a dynamic pop-up bubble to display context-specific information and enhance user interaction.

Module 2 – Geospatial Shape Drawing

Module 2 delves into the powerful capabilities of drawing various geometric shapes to enhance your map's visual communication. You'll learn to programmatically add and precisely position circles, polygons (for complex areas), polylines (for routes and paths), and rectangles on your map. Beyond mere placement, you'll gain expertise in customizing the visual attributes of these shapes – including stroke color, fill color, weight, and opacity – allowing you to effectively highlight specific geographical areas, define boundaries, or trace intricate paths to convey information clearly.

Module 3 – Event Handling & User Interactions

Elevate your maps from static displays to dynamic, responsive interfaces in Module 3. This section focuses on capturing and responding to a variety of user interactions and map events. You'll discover how to implement event listeners for actions such as user clicks on the map or its elements, changes in the zoom level, and modifications to the map's visible geographical boundaries (bounds). This knowledge will empower you to create truly interactive experiences that react intelligently to user behavior, providing a more engaging and functional map.

Module 4 – Advanced Markers & Clustering Techniques

Building on your marker knowledge, Module 4 introduces advanced techniques for visual appeal and performance. You'll learn to move beyond default markers by customizing them with unique icons to reflect different data types or points of interest. Furthermore, you'll explore how to add subtle animations to markers for a more engaging user experience. Crucially, this module covers marker clustering – a vital technique for efficiently managing and displaying a large number of markers without overwhelming the user, dynamically grouping them at different zoom levels for improved readability and performance.

Module 5 – Full Course Expansion Preview

Conclude your introductory journey with an exciting glimpse into the broader potential of the Google Maps API in Module 5. This section provides a sneak peek at advanced functionalities not covered in detail in this beginner course but explored in our comprehensive full program. You'll be introduced to features like location autocomplete for streamlined input, the powerful directions service for calculating routes, and sophisticated routing optimizations. This preview will illustrate how expanding your knowledge further can unlock even more complex and practical mapping solutions for real-world applications, showcasing the full scope of what you can achieve.

Deal Source: real.discount